Edge Banding Machines: Achieving Perfect Edges
In today's woodworking shops , edge banding equipment are vital for producing furniture and cabinetry with a professional appearance . These specialized tools apply a delicate layer of edging to the raw edges of panels , concealing blemishes and boosting the overall aesthetic . Employing edge banding processes ensures a durable and consistent edge profile , minimizing the need for manual smoothing and likely conserving valuable effort.}

CNC Panel Saws: Maximizing Large Format Material Cutting
CNC table saws streamline the process of slicing large format product, offering unparalleled precision and performance. These modern machines manage the complete cutting procedure , minimizing scrap and increasing output . By employing computer numerical control , CNC sheet saws can quickly and consistently produce complex shapes with minimal operator involvement . This makes them an essential answer for millwork manufacturers and other businesses that regularly work with substantial sheets.

Boosting Your Workshop: Integrating Edge Banders and CNC Routers
To really improve your woodworking shop, consider linking an edge bander and a CNC router. These robust machines, when employed together, offer a substantial advantage in efficiency. A CNC router can accurately form panels to your specific designs, and then an edge bander can easily apply high-quality edge banding for a finished look. This combination minimizes work and increases the total quality of your projects.
